728x90 string1 [JAVA] String, StringBuffer, StringBuilder String1. 불변(immutable)2. 문자열 추가, 수정, 삭제가 적을 경우 사용3. 문자열 데이터 동등 비교시, equals() 사용 String s1 = "Hello"; // 문자열 리터럴을 이용한 방식String s2 = new String("Hello"); // new 연산자를 이용한 방식 // 리터럴과 객체 문자열 비교System.out.println(s1 == s2); // falseSystem.out.println(s2.equals(s1)); // true StringBuffer / StringBuilder1. 가변(mutable)2. 문자열 추가, 수정, 삭제가 빈번할 경우 사용3. 문자열 데이터 동등 비교시, String 객체로 변환 후, equals.. 2024. 7. 22. 이전 1 다음 728x90